Comprehending Debt Management Strategies
Navigating money burdens can appear overwhelming. Implementing effective debt management plans is crucial for regaining stability. A well-structured strategy typically involves a mixture of techniques tailored to your individual circumstances. Commonly utilized strategies include:
* **Creating a Budget:** Recording your revenue and expenses is the base of any successful debt management approach.
* **Prioritizing Debts:** Categorizing your debts by interest rate or amount can help you distribute payments effectively.
* **Debt Consolidation:** Merging multiple debts into a single loan with a potentially lower interest rate may simplify your repayments.
* **Debt Negotiation:** Negotiating with creditors to minimize interest rates or monthly payments can present some support.
* **Seeking Professional Guidance:** A certified financial advisor or credit counselor can provide customized advice and assist you in developing a comprehensive debt management approach.
